当您手动安装程序并希望将它们添加到上下文菜单中的“打开方式”列表时,通常必须创建和编辑多个.desktop
文件,我认为这相当麻烦,因为有很多方法可能会出错。有没有一个带有 GUI 的程序可以为您做到这一点?(或者甚至可能是原生方式?)
我已经找到了alacarte
,但是这只会使您的程序可添加到启动器中。
答案1
您可以使用 GUI 工具完成“困难”的部分(即.desktop
在中创建启动器) ,然后手动对文件进行微小的修改。~/.local/share/applications/
alacarte
.desktop
请注意,.desktop
使用 创建的启动器alcarte
位于 中~/.local/share/applications/
,通常以 形式命名alacarte-made*.desktop
。您需要使用文本编辑器打开此类文件并检查/修改以下几项:
- 应该有
NoDisplay=true
一行。这会将应用程序从应用程序菜单中隐藏。因此请添加(或修改)一行NoDisplay=true
。 确保有适当的字段代码(
%f
/%F
/%u
/%U
)位于行末Exec=
。这意味着该行应该看起来像Exec=/path/to/the/program %f
或者类似的东西,不是简单地
Exec=/path/to/the/program